Prolijo Tequila Blanco opens with a challenging nose—heavy on hay and funk—that may be off-putting at first. However, the palate tells a different story, offering a much sweeter experience than expected, with soft cooked agave and light citrus notes. The mouthfeel is on the thinner side, but the short finish is clean and pleasant, leaving behind a subtle bitter sweetness. It's a decent tequila, although the initial aroma may be a hurdle for some.
